Have any of you 55 owners replaced the fuzzies in the curved roof track of a 55 2 door hardtop? If so what did you use and where did you find it? I've bought a lot of 55 pieces from Steele Rubber, but they don't show anything for that piece. Thanks.

I have not replaced these on a 2 dr. Hardtop,but you might look and see if the 55- 57 Chevy BelAir 2 dr. Hardtop looks the same. They are readily available. If not, I believe Fusick list them. You might also check Rubber The Right Way or Metro Weatherstrips. Good luck, Larry

Found mine at a local glass shop. I believe they are rather universal and can be made to fit many years and styles of cars. Have you tried any of the local shops in your area? ...Tedd

Thanks for the replies. Hadn't thought of local glass companies(we only have one). Saw on Danchuk's website for Chevies, that they sell a moleskin type material that glues in. That's not what was in originally, but might be the best I can do. The originals were fuzzies similar to those on the front glass, but curved to fit. Thanks again.
